KWWW-FM
KWWW-FM (96.7 FM, "KW3") is a radio station broadcasting a contemporary hit radio music format. The station went on the air in 1985, built by Jim Corcoran, who owned KWWW in Wenatchee. Licensed to Quincy, Washington, United States, the station is currently owned by Townsquare Media.
